PartsTrader 3.0 Released

May 6, 2015

May 6, 2015—PartsTrader announced on Tuesday that rollout plans have begun for PartsTrader 3.0.

PartsTrader 3.0 aims to allow users to gain more efficiency in parts procurement while also allowing access to better reporting tools to help manage their businesses, according to a company statement. Highlights in the release of PartsTrader 3.0 will include a redesigned Quote Selection Tool, inventory quoting capabilities and enhanced management reporting.


The time saving inventory quoting system will be rolled out in phases, first is the Hotlines Automach integration for recycled parts supplies followed by DMI data platform for OEM dealers. Suppliers will be able to see their inventory within the application and have the capability to quote inventory with a single click.
